Testing 911 with Teams app (via 933) using Teams and Operator connect. I have user emergecny calling policy enabled to use external location lookup. On the iPhone (15), I also have location services for Teams enabled and precise location "on". When I open the Teams app, the map correctly shows the location; I allow it to be used. I dial 933 and the address it determined is indeed correct, but it says "low confidence" and would have gone to screening center. I've tried a few different things and from a few locations with same result - the address/location is identified correctly, but 933 test call still says it was low confidence. I can't figure out why or how to get it to be recognized as a "valid" address to not go to screening center.1KViews0likes2Comments
